In issues surrounding mental health awareness and an aging population, neuroscience is a field that is booming in the workforce – and at Carleton University.

“Neuroscience is an area of growing public interest,” says John Stead, chair of Carleton’s Department of Neuroscience. “And we’re a new department, so we have an energy to us.”

“We are the first university in the country to have a department in neuroscience that offers its own undergraduate programs,” says Stead. “There are a huge number of new courses and, by this Christmas, we will have taught 12 brand new courses in two and a half years.”
